Seguin stuck out of the middle in Boston?

08:00 AM ET 09.15 | Traditionally, a team picking so high in the draft has more holes. Had the Taylor vs. Tyler debate ended differently -- with the Edmonton Oilers taking [Tyler] Seguin first overall instead of Taylor Hall -- this would be less of an issue. Seguin probably would be playing in the NHL immediately, even though he is only 18. The Oilers need help at center. Had Seguin gone second overall to the Toronto Maple Leafs, who traded the pick to the Bruins in the Phil Kessel deal a year ago, same thing. Had he gone third overall to the Florida Panthers or fourth overall to the Columbus Blue Jackets ... well, you can go down the list. But the fact is, Seguin went to the Bruins.
